First, it’s all about hydration. Minor lines often start as “dehydration wrinkles,” which are temporary but can become permanent if skin stays dry. Purilax tackles this head-on with a blend of humectants like hyaluronic acid and glycerin. These ingredients work like magnets for moisture, plumping up the skin’s surface and smoothing out those faint creases. Users often notice a visible difference within a week of consistent use, especially in areas prone to dryness.

But hydration alone isn’t enough for long-term results. Purilax also incorporates peptides—short chains of amino acids that act as messengers in the skin. One key peptide in the formula, palmitoyl tripeptide-1, encourages collagen production. Collagen is the protein responsible for keeping skin firm, and boosting it helps prevent minor lines from deepening over time. Think of it as giving your skin a gentle nudge to rebuild its natural support system.

Another standout feature is the product’s antioxidant lineup. Ingredients like vitamin C and green tea extract neutralize free radicals caused by UV exposure, pollution, or stress. These environmental factors break down collagen and elastin, making minor lines more noticeable. By fighting oxidative stress, Purilax helps maintain the skin’s resilience, which is crucial for anyone juggling a busy lifestyle.
